Competitions
Challenge yourself!
Eligible contestants:
- All current SCU students are eligible to participate.
- SCU Alumni are allowed to participate (alumni who graduated before 2000 must have a current SCU student in thier team).
- SCU Faculty are allowed to participate.
- Those people are not associated with SCU may participate if they have current SCU students on their teams.
- Those people who just graduated can participate without the need for a current student.
How it will work:
- A judging panel composed of professionals from the Industry & Academia, Industry Executives and Venture Capitalists will determine the winning teams.
- Winning teams will get guaranteed time with top Venture Capitalist firms in Silicon Valley.
Rewards:
- Monetary prizes provide by John Ocampo, a co-founder and Chairman of the Board for Sirenza
- $5000 for best overall business plan
- $3000 for most innovative idea
- $2000 in other prizes
- Exposure to professionals in Industry and Academia
- Exposure to Venture Capitalists
- A chance to work with multiple disciplines towards a common goal, and have your ideas recognized!
